Support during the holidays

Festive K and C Mind

Christmas can be an exciting time of the year for many. But it can also be a challenging time, especially for those living with a mental health problem.

For those of you who might be struggling, or who are supporting someone who is struggling, we’d like to share some ways you can find support over the holidays.

Helpful resources

  • Elefriends is a really supportive online community where you can be yourself, share and be heard. There is someone on hand to speak to you every night till midnight.           
  • Samaritans are available to talk 24/7 about whatever is on your mind.
  • Healing Minds is a consortium of independent, registered voluntary organisations who provide advice, counselling and support to people living in Kensington and Chelsea.  
  • Mind’s A-Z of mental health information covers over 100 topics, including coping tips for a range of diagnoses, and ways that family and friends can support.
